On 07/28/06 13:17, Thomas Börkel wrote:

>I have 2 Input Sources, analog and DVB. Most of the channels are 
>identical and some are exclusively analog or DVB.
>
>Now I have each identical channel twice, for example I have the channel 
>"RTL" on id 6 (analog) and 656 (DVB). Both have the same call sign and 
>XMLTVID. I have imported XMLTV data with mythfilldatabase for both Input 
>Sources.
>
>Now when I search for shows through frontend (alphabetical Program 
>Finder) or MythWeb (search), each show is listed twice, one time for 
>channel 6 and 656.
>
>Am I doing something wrong?
>
>Can I tell MythTV somehow, that this really is the same channel (the 
>scheduler seems to do correctly)?
>

You tell Myth two channels are the same by giving them the same 
callsign.  Use the mythtv-setup channel editor to do this.

You tell Myth to show the channel only once in the EPG by giving the 
channels the same callsign /and/ the same channel number (again in the 
mythtv-setup channel editor).  You can edit the channel number you like 
least (I would change 656 to 6) and it won't affect tuning.  Just make 
sure you do /not/ change the frequency ID.

Note, though, that even with the same channel number and callsign, you 
may see multiple results in search lists (but you might not :).
